Mesothelioma compensation claims can help patients and their families pay expenses related to treatment. These claims may also cover caregiving expenses and other losses caused by asbestos exposure.
Compensation is available through the trust fund or lawsuit for mesothelioma. An experienced asbestos lawyer can analyze your case and recommend the most appropriate claim for you.
Medical expenses
Mesothelioma treatment can be costly. This is why many sufferers face financial hardship due to medical bills and loss of income. Fortunately, asbestos sufferers may be entitled to compensation through asbestos trust funds or lawsuits. These funds can be used to cover the costs and ensure that the victims and their families are financially secure for years to be.
Patients with mesothelioma must pay for a range of medical expenses like chemotherapy, hospitalizations and surgeries. These expenses can be extremely costly, and patients should keep the track of all expenses out of pocket to help build their mesothelioma case later on.
A typical chemotherapy regimen that consists of pemetrexed and cisplatin (Alimta), for example it costs between $40,000 and $50,000 for an infusion over several weeks. Additionally, a patient might require lung-related surgeries like a pneumonectomy. Surgical bills typically total between $20,000 and $30,000.
Many patients with mesothelioma also hire caregivers to help with routine tasks and other errands. The cost of caregivers, transportation, and lodging can quickly add up. Patients often seek out complementary or alternative treatments, like yoga or acupuncture, to improve their health and reduce mesothelioma-related side effects. In a study conducted in 2016, mesothelioma patients reported spending between $400 and $650 a year on these therapies. Fortunately, mesothelioma lawyers are able to help with the tracking and arranging of expenses to help create a lawsuit case.
Treatment grants
Treatment grants can help victims and their families pay for the various costs related to mesothelioma. These include travel and housing costs. Some non-profit organizations offer grants to help cancer patients. These grants can also be used to pay for copays, prescriptions and other medical expenses. Many pharmaceutical companies also provide patient assistance programs. A mesothelioma attorney can assist victims in finding financial aid.
Asbestos-related patients may be eligible for disability benefits. Many people diagnosed with mesothelioma are veterans and are eligible for benefits of the veteran's pension. They could also be eligible for long-term disability insurance, which will pay a percentage of their income while they are unable to work. Some individuals may also be eligible for Social Security disability payments that will provide them with an income for the month.

Trust fund claims
Mesothelioma patients are able to claim trust fund claims in order to receive compensation from asbestos companies which went bankrupt. These trusts are in bankruptcy and offer billions of dollars to asbestos victims. The amount of money that a victim receives from a mesothelioma fund depends on a number of factors that include their medical history as well as their work history.
A mesothelioma lawyer can help those affected and their families make a claim. They will review medical documents, military records and work history to determine where asbestos exposure occurred. They will also create an inventory of asbestos-containing items, including their manufacturers. This will allow the victim to qualify for the highest payouts from asbestos trusts.
The mesothelioma compensation process can take months or longer depending on the type of legal action involved and how complex it is. However, a knowledgeable mesothelioma law firm can accelerate the process and ensure that all eligibility requirements are met.

VA benefits
Veterans suffering from mesothelioma or any other asbestos-related diseases could be eligible for VA benefits. They may also be eligible for compensation from trust funds, lawsuit payouts or settlements. These awards of compensation can aid in the payment of treatment or related expenses.
Patients with mesothelioma must focus on their own health. This can be difficult for those who do not have access to financial aid. Compensation can cover expenses like living and travel expenses. Mesothelioma patients often put their lives on hold while undergoing treatment, therefore having quick access to funds allows them to concentrate on their health and keep their families moving forward.
Veterans with mesothelioma may receive a special monthly VA compensation referred to as "Aid & Attendance" (A&A). This tax-free benefit aids veterans with mesothelioma and other asbestos-related diseases pay for their expenses for daily care like in-home nurses services. A&A can also help cover costs for home maintenance and utility bills.
Some mesothelioma attorneys work with a VA-accredited claims agent to ensure that each benefit application is completed without errors and in line with VA guidelines. This can increase the odds of a veteran receiving benefits. Also, veterans who are eligible for mesothelioma compensation can use their awards to receive no-cost or low-cost treatment from mesothelioma specialists in the VA system. This is in addition to any pension or disability compensation they may receive.
Disability benefits
Due to their condition, mesothelioma sufferers typically require disability benefits. In order to qualify for Social Security disability, a person must be able to provide documentation that shows they are not able to engage in a substantial and lucrative work due to their medical conditions. Mesothelioma lawyers can help you obtain the documentation needed to file a successful claim for disability.
When it comes to Social Security disability, mesothelioma victims must submit detailed medical records that document the nature and location of the disease, as well as the prognosis and severity. A doctor's opinion is required to be included in the application, as along with the report of pathology and operative notes. All of the documents required will expedite the approval process.
The SSA has a program known as Compassionate Allowances which assists to identify serious conditions so that the agency can review them faster. This can accelerate the process of getting approval for mesothelioma-related benefits.
